We show that the product of a compact sequential T 2 ‐space, with an absolutely countably compact T 3 ‐space, is absolutely countably compact, and give several related results. For example, we show that every countably compact GO‐space is absolutely countably compact, and that the product of a compact T 2 ‐space of countable tightness with an absolutely countably compact, ω‐bounded T 3 ‐space (in particular a countably compact GO‐space) is absolutely countably compact.
